👩‍👧 Family Devotional — Day 29

“When the World Pushes Back”

📖 “They hated Me without a cause.”
—John 15:25b (NKJV)


Faithfulness to Christ will not always be met with applause.
In fact, Jesus told us to expect the opposite.

He was hated—without cause.
Not for wrongdoing, but for His righteousness.

In the same way, a family who walks in truth, raises their children in godliness, and rejects cultural compromise will eventually feel resistance.

It may come from extended family, social settings, or even within the church.
But the comfort lies here: we are in good company.

Jesus was rejected first.
And He remained steadfast.

We are not called to stir up conflict, but we are called to stand when it comes—graciously, truthfully, and with unwavering love.


Family Reflection:

  • How has your family experienced resistance for choosing to follow Christ?
  • How can you prepare your children to respond like Jesus did?

Prayer:
Lord, when the world pushes back against our faith, help us to remember that You were hated without cause. Give our family strength to stand together in truth and grace, just as You did. Amen.
